Teaching Personnel are seeking to appoint an Humanities Teacher for a School in the Tyne and Wear Region to cover a maternity leave. The role is temporary until July 2019 at the moment however, does have the possibility of being extended. The key responsibilities of a successful candidate will be to plan and prepare lessons that will be delivered across the KS3-KS5 Curriculum.
The School is an 11 to 16 secondary school with approximately 1000 students and is based in Newcastle upon Tyne. The school has a thriving community of students, parents, staff and governors who work together to provide an engaging learning environment which encourages students to reach their full potential.
The most recent OFSTED inspection judged the overall effectiveness of the school as good. The core values of respect, ambition and determination are demonstrated throughout the curriculum as well as within extra-curricular opportunities. Academic excellence is at the heart of the school and learning is designed to be exciting, stimulating and relevant to students' lives in the 21st century.
The School requires for April 2019 a good to outstanding Teacher of Humanities to join their well established, supportive and innovative team. This is an exciting opportunity for an individual who has a vision for innovative learning and teaching strategies to ensure the highest standards of achievement for our students. Applications from NQT are welcomed and an excellent programme of support is in place to ensure successful completion for staff.
You will have the opportunity to be paid in line with MPS/UPS - £23,720 - £39,406.
